Workflows that support experimental research activities largely feature the same general patterns and consist of the same general steps, referred to as paths or flows. DOE Office of Science user facilities.įinding the patterns underlying data analysis workflows Department of Energy’s (DOE) Argonne National Laboratory presented new techniques for automating inter-facility workflows-workflows such as those that involve transferring data obtained from beamlines at Argonne’s Advanced Photon Source (APS) to the Argonne Leadership Computing Facility (ALCF) resources for analysis-by identifying how to express their component processes in abstract terms that make the workflows reusable. However, new ways of implementing the automation of research processes are necessary to fully utilize the power of leading-edge computational and data technologies.Ī team of researchers at the U.S. As large-scale experiments generate an ever-increasing amount of scientific data, automating research tasks, such as data transfers and analysis, is critical to helping scientists sort through the results to make new discoveries.
